Let’s look at some of the most obvious home business ideas. What are you doing for a living currently? Would you be happy doing that job if you were doing it for yourself? You really have to question whether it’s the job itself you don’t like or just the company you work for. If it turns out you like the job, maybe you can create a way to do that job in your own home business. Many businesses outsource work to assist them in meeting their company goals. Look for ways to outsource yourself doing what you’re doing right now.
If you happen to hate the job you’re doing entirely, there are still hundreds of other ways to have a home business. Selling stuff online is one example. Start your own retail business online using drop shippers and never have to touch product at all. Ebay, Amazon, and other sites are booming with folks selling stuff online. There’s also affiliate marketing programs you can get involved with. Loads of people are making good money marketing affiliate sites online. Do you have a passion for writing? Why not blog, ghost write articles, or even place ads for other people for money. Bloggers alone are making full-time incomes just posting to their blogs everyday. Blog about something you love like gardening, home improvement, cars, or whatever. Build a following of readers and develop customers from those readers. The point is, be creative in your thinking. There are literally hundreds of jobs that you can turn into a lucrative home business.
Set some time aside and sit down and make a list of the subjects you are good at, interested in, or want to be interested in. This is going to become your list for your potential online business. Then start narrowing that list down, again keeping in mind that this is a job you will be doing years from now. Go to your family and friends and ask their opinion about your potential home business ideas. Sometimes an objective view can help you make your final decision on which business. While making this list up, or after you have made a decision, look at ways to start up without leaving your current position. It’s always nice to have an income flow while you are trying to build a business. Soon you will be working at something you enjoy and working for yourself.
